Cowboys Strengthen Linebacker Corps with Murray and Sanborn Signings

According to Ian Rapoport of the NFL Network, the Dallas Cowboys are finalizing a trade with the Tennessee Titans to acquire linebacker Kenneth Murray.

The deal includes an exchange of late-round draft picks between the two teams. Murray, a former first-round pick, brings athleticism and experience to Dallas’ linebacker unit.

In addition to the trade, the Cowboys are also expected to sign free-agent linebacker Jack Sanborn to a one-year deal. Sanborn, known for his physical play and instincts, adds depth and competition.

These moves signal Dallas’ commitment to bolstering its defense especially the linebacker unit for the 2025 season.
